Healthcare Computing - HC98
23-25th March 1998, Harrogate, UK
Organised by Health Informatics Committee (HIC)
British Computer Society
Attendance Bursaries for Delegates from (Re)Emerging Countries
The British Computer Society Health Informatics Committee (HIC) invites
applications from colleagues in the (re)emerging nations who would like
to participate in the annual UK conference and exhibition Healthcare
Computing - HC98
This prestigious event will be held in Harrogate, Yorkshire, UK from
23-25th March 1998.
Over 1200 delegates from UK, Europe, USA and the East attend the event.
Over 3000 people attend the associated exhibition in 4 halls.
Bursaries are available to cover Event Registration, and travel (within
UK only), accommodation and subsistence for the duration of HC98.
Candidates are requested to submit a short resume (maximum 500 words)
of why they feel that they will benefit from attendance at HC98. The
application should include:
- current position and brief job description
- contact details : address, telephone, facsimile number and e-mail ad-
dress (if appropriate)
- reason for wishing to attend HC98
- how you would disseminate the information gained when you return home
All those awarded the bursaries will be required to submit a short pa-
per or poster on the state of health Informatics in their country and
the key issues to be addressed in national or local developments in-
their particular field. If suitable this will be included in volume 2
of the conference proceedings.
The proceedings at HC98 are in English with no translation facilities,
so the HIC feel that the candidates will typically be
- competent in both written and spoken English
- in a position to be able to contribute significantly to the
development of Health Informatics in their home country in any
clinical or health management discipline
- aged between 30 and 50, and in a key role in their organisation

Successful applicants will be notified by 15th February 1998
Please note:
1) Bursaries are not available to previous bursary holders
2) Successful candidates are responsible for finding funds to get
themselves to the UK and home again
3) The bursary does not cover the costs of bringing a partner
4) Priority will be given to candidates who have not previously at-
tended an HC Conference within the last 4 years
